Lisa was an exceptional woman, wife, artisan and hostess. She continued to create beautiful ceramic house numbers and New Orleans themed decor at her pottery studio through 2021. Her love of all things New Orleans was also displayed in her home, There were never too many fleur de lis representations for any room, never too much purple for Mardi Gras. Every year she hand delivered home-made Christmas goodies in colorful packages. Many children of friends and relatives learned the basics of baking with Aunt Lisa. But no human was the benefactor of her most special attention-- that was reserved for her pets. It’s a joy to know she is reunited with her beloved dogs and cats.
Lisa always loved cars and racing, even as a child. She and Miles went to Talladega for NASCAR racing and to California and Indianapolis for Formula One races. Traveling in their RV was a way to visit family and friends and see amazing places. Lisa’s love of gardening, music, entertaining and welcoming friends and guests to her home was well known. Many looked forward to the annual Thoth parade party, birthday celebrations and special moments she hosted. Lisa leaves behind multitudes of friends of all ages, both near and far. We will miss her beautiful presence, and we are all better people because of her love.
